## Order Cutoff Handling

The Crumbledown bakery platform enforces a hard 4 p.m. cutoff for next-day orders. If the cutoff job stalls, on-call must manually trigger the `cutoff-sweep` task against the Ovenline scheduler before 4:30 p.m. To run the sweep against the internal scheduler API, authenticate using the key provided immediately below.

gateway credential: kto11_pTkcHgLwuNE

Subject: Handover — dependency pinning policy

Hi Teodor,

Before I rotate off, a summary for the support queue: all database tooling in the Copperfen stack is pinned to exact versions in `pins.lock`. Minor bumps need a ticket; majors need a staging soak of one week. If support reports a driver mismatch, check the lockfile first — unpinned installs are the usual culprit. The pin audit job writes its results to the ops database nightly. You can reach that database with the connection string below.

Thanks,
Ilsa

primary connection of yagep-kahip = redis://giliel_svc:zYiKsLL2PLpfPL@db-348f.xolmarsys.corp:5432/fenwyn

MEMO — Branch Managers Only

Subject: Sale of the Cartwheel Logistics unit

Deal with Hullbright Holdings signed Tuesday. Close expected within eight weeks, pending clearance. Cartwheel staff transfer with the unit; no branch redundancies. Customer migration handled centrally — do not field questions locally, route them to Corporate Affairs. Signage and systems change at close, not before. Hold all Cartwheel-related quotes until further notice. One confidential item on forward plans follows.

internal memo for kawip-hadug: Headcount on the Wenwyn team goes from 7 to 140 by the end of January. Gross margin on Wenwyn came in at 20 percent against a plan of 15 percent.